James 3:1-12

Be ye not many teachers, my brethren, knowing that we shall receive the greater judgment. For we all fail in many things; if any one fails not in word, the same is a perfect man, able even to bridle the whole body. But if we put bridles into the mouths of the horses, that they may obey us; and we manage their whole body;read more.
behold also the ships, being so great, and driven by fierce winds, are managed by the smallest rudder, whithersoever the will of the steersman prefers; so also the tongue is a little member, and it boasts great things. Behold, how great a wood a little fire kindles! The tongue, a fire, the world of iniquity: the tongue sits down in the midst of our members, and corrupting the whole body, and setting on fire the course of nature; and it is set on fire from hell. For every nature both of wild beasts, and of birds, and of creeping things, and of oceanic animals, is subdued, and has been subjugated to human nature: but no one of men is able to tame the tongue; an incorrigible evil, full of deadly poison. With it we bless the Lord, even the Father; and with it we scold the people, who have been made after the image of God: out of the same mouth come forth blessing and scolding. My brethren, these things ought not so to be. Whether does the fountain out of the same chink send forth sweet water and bitter? My brethren, whether is the fig-tree able to produce olives, or the vine figs? Neither is the bitter fountain able to produce sweet water.

Matthew 12:34-37

O ye generations of vipers, how are you, being evil, able to speak good things? for out of the abundance of the heart the mouth speaks. The good man, out of the good treasure (heart) brings forth good things: and the wicked man out of the wicked treasure (heart) brings forth wicked things. And I say unto you, that every idle word whatsoever men shall speak, they shall give an account concerning the same in the day of judgment.read more.
For by thy words thou shalt be justified, and by thy words thou shah be condemned.

Matthew 15:10-20

And calling the multitude to Him, He said to them, Hear and understand: That if which cometh into the mouth does not defile the man; but that which cometh out from the mouth, that defiles the man. Then His disciples having come to Him say, Do you not know that the Pharisees hearing your word, were offended?read more.
And He responding said, Every plant which my heavenly Father did not plant, shall be rooted up. Let them alone: the blind are leaders of the blind: if the blind may lead the blind, both will fall into the ditch. Peter responding said to Him, Explain unto us the parable. And Jesus said, Are you indeed still without understanding? Do you know that everything entering into the mouth goes into the stomach, and is cast out into excrement? But those things going out from the mouth come forth from the heart; and these pollute the man. For out of the heart proceed evil reasonings, murders, fornications, adulteries, thefts, false testimonies, blasphemies. These are the things which defile the man: but to eat bread with unwashed hands does not defile the man.
